In this book, we explore the role of a librarian. Leela is a librarian who helps visitors and the local community. From finding books for people to organizing library events, Leela is always happy to help. Leela the Librarian is in Gold Book Band, Oxford Reading Level 9. Project X Hero Academy Non-fiction is an inspirational series of books which broadens children's subject knowledge, while consolidating their phonics learning and improving their reading fluency.

Smriti Prasadam-Halls is a former children's book editor and the author of several books, including Jingle Jangle Jungle and Muddle Farm , both illustrated by Axel Scheffler. Smriti lives in Surrey with her husband and three young sons.
